Output cf8f54be4c5b6e3dfc3c27f7a04a57792837f38247c9a966323e8c7052f1c0e6:3

value
905469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e68c8b24e00bf0657537092c36e30e8bab57f3b OP_EQUAL
address
3G8cDNTu4WR8xMvvFfZEcTxrjXnvfDacFb
transaction
cf8f54be4c5b6e3dfc3c27f7a04a57792837f38247c9a966323e8c7052f1c0e6
confirmations
486579
spent
true